Welcome to the rotation. Because plugin authors can influence assignment scoring, you should understand how the Routeplane heuristic weighs distance, driver rating, and plugin-supplied bonuses before touching anything. Misbehaving plugins are throttled automatically, so a drop in assignments usually indicates a scoring plugin returning out-of-range values rather than a core fault. Verify plugin scores in the audit log before escalating. The scoring contract, valid ranges, and throttle rules are specified on the internal page below.

wiki page, yaguf-bawig: https://jira.norvacorp.internal/browse/display/view/b5a061abb09d

# Service Accounts: Prunebot

Prunebot, the stale-branch cleanup bot on the Carrowforge platform, runs under a dedicated service account with repository-admin scope only. Plugin authors extending Prunebot's retention rules must route all calls through the Wrenhall internal API rather than calling the git layer directly. Each request is audited and rate-limited. Authenticate those requests using the service key below.

API key for tagef-fafop: vxb2-ta

## Formula sandbox tuning

User-supplied formulas in Gridmoor execute inside a restricted interpreter with hard ceilings on time, memory, and call depth. Reviewers should confirm any change to these ceilings is justified in the PR description, since raising them widens the abuse surface. Defaults were chosen from production traces. The current limits are as follows.

limits module of tafog-fawip:
WEIGHTS = {
    "julix": 57,
    "lamys": 992,
    "kasvan": 209,
    "quenok": 750,
    "alddor": 259,
    "oliath": 1009,
    "wenix": 815,
}

# Break-Glass Access — Graphwell Dependency Visualizer

If the Graphwell rendering service fails during a release freeze and the owning team (Cartographers) is unreachable, the release manager may invoke break-glass access. This bypasses the normal approval chain in Ledgerline and grants a two-hour admin session, which is fully audited. Use it only when a broken dependency graph is actively blocking a cut. The break-glass prompt will reject your normal credentials; it accepts only the recovery passphrase below.

strongbox words: zorwyn-sorael-belion-ulaius-silmir-ulays-briax-rusdor-gorix